Thunderstorms – a typical summer phenomenon
The thunderstorm season usually begins around May and ends in September, with the summer months of June, July and August bringing by far the most thunderstorms.
The vertical temperature gradients are a key element for thunderstorms. If the atmosphere is stably layer, no convection can occur, which prevents thunderstorms. Late autumn and winter are practically free of thunderstorms, because in high pressure weather the atmosphere is not only stably layer, but strong inversion layers often prevail for several days. This is due to the overall negative radiation balance, especially in the lower layers of the atmosphere.
It’s different in summer. The strong sunlight heats up the air layers close to the ground, creating unstable air stratification, especially during the day. In special cases, this can lead to convection. If the atmosphere is sufficiently humid, cumulus clouds form, which can lead to thunderstorms.
Temperature gradient between Locarno-Monti
and Cimetta. The temperature gradient is significantly higher in the summer months than in winter. It should be not that these are monthly averages. During the day, the values are significantly higher and reach up to 0.8 degrees/100 meters in the summer months, especially in sunny conditions. In the open atmosphere, these gradients would be significantly higher again, because it is 1 to 2 degrees cooler there during the day than at a summit station. Nevertheless, this figure clearly shows that in summer the atmosphere is less stably layer and thunderstorms are more likely, at least in terms of instability.

Thunderstorms are most common in southern Ticino
The frequency of thunderstorms varies in Switzerland. Thunderstorms fix “content not yet available most frequently develop in southern Ticino. There they occur in different weather conditions. On the one hand, these are low-pressure areas, but thunderstorms can also occur in southerly conditions. In the case of southerly congestion, thunderstorms often contribute significantly to the high rainfall that falls in western Ticino. The daily totals, which can significantly exce 400 mm, are not always evenly distribut over 24 hours. Instead, heavy downpours can fall between individual breaks, with up to 100 mm possible within an hour.
